1. The HOME-COOKED Menu That Will Have You Coming Back for More
The heart and soul of Kamayan For a Cause lies in the food. Every year, we serve up a mouthwatering Filipino feast that’s prepared with love and tradition by our very own family members.
What’s on the menu?
Ron’s Famous Filipino BBQ – Coal-charred pork and chicken, marinated for days in a secret blend of spices.
Karon’s Pork Lumpia – Crispy, golden lumpia that will have you asking for more.
Kay’s Fried Chicken with Lemongrass and Herbs – Crispy on the outside, tender on the inside, with a Filipino twist.
Ann’s Seafood Boil - a hearty mix of tender shrimp, sweet corn on the cob, and baby potatoes all tossed in a signature blend of Old Bay seasoning and fresh garlic rub
Sweet endings with – Mama Es’ Bibinka cups (A soft, fluffy Filipino rice cake baked in banana leaves, with a hint of coconut and a touch of sweetness), Turon (a crispy golden spring roll wrapped ripe banana, lightly caramelized with brown sugar for the perfect sweet crunch), and ube crinkle cookies that are the perfect finale to your meal.
This home-cooked meal is the epitome of Filipino comfort food, and it’s guaranteed to satisfy your cravings for the authentic flavors of the Philippines. Imagine carts of foods circulating dim-sum style, but plating the Filipino way?!

3. entertainment and giveaways for All Ages and the Pabitin for the Kids
Kamayan isn’t just about food—it’s a fun-filled day for the whole family. Whether you’re a child or an adult, there’s something for everyone to enjoy.
Games for All Ages – Siblings took center stage in the Newspaper Dance Game, where pairs had to keep dancing as their newspaper “dance floor” kept shrinking. Older kids challenge to the unscramble game where they unscrambled words to complete the correct sentence. Best of all, every child went home a winner with prizes like $1 cash or even a lottery ticket!
The Pabitin – A beloved Filipino tradition, this Filipino piñata is filled with prizes like candies and small toys. The kids love jumping and reaching for the goodies, making it a highlight of the day.
Sari Sari Store: Just like in the Philippines, our Sari-Sari Store offered fun take-home giveaways and small treasures, letting families bring a little piece of Kamayan home with them.
